Allworth Financial is an independent investment financial advisory firm specializing in retirement planning, investment advising, and 401(k) management with a direct approach to financial planning. The firm delivers long- and short-term investment planning solutions to help clients achieve their goals and plan strategically for retirement. Founded in Sacramento, California, in 1993, Allworth is a high-growth, private equity-backed, multi-branch Registered Investment Advisor. As a fee-based, employee-centric fiduciary advisory firm, Allworth emphasizes client well-being and education. The firm manages multi-billion dollar assets and is recognized for its strong organic growth and acquisitions, earning the "Circle of Excellence" award for employee and client satisfaction and being named a Barron's Top 40 RIA in 2024.
